Plot Summary
BLACK NIGHT LEGEND "DOOMSDAY" was a concert held on March 2, 2014, at Nippon Budokan in Tokyo, Japan. BABYMETAL became the youngest band to perform at the venue. During BLACK NIGHT, after performing all their songs, BABYMETAL concluded the first chapter of "Metal Resistance" and announced their journey to perform overseas. A large coffin appeared on stage, and the members entered it as it rose, ending the "Summoning Ceremony." At the end, LEGEND "Y" and LEGEND "M" in Europe were announced on the screen.
